Amortization Period
The total time period over which a loan or mortgage is scheduled to be paid off through regular payments.
Compounded Semi-annually
A method of calculating interest where the earned interest is added to the principal every six months, allowing interest to be earned on the previously earned interest.
Lump Payment
A single, large payment made at once, instead of breaking it into smaller installments.
